Description

Whether Vedic people were indigenous habitants or emigrants is a hotly debated issue. Author Sanjay Sonawani tries to find the answers of this question. This book postulates a theory on the issue of the IE languages and origins of the vedic as well as the Zoroastrian religions. It diligently explains how the religious and cultural ethos of the Indus-Ghaggar Civilization has flowed to us uninterrupted and exposes the schemes of the Vedicist scholars.
